Accident Summary Nr: 202656641 - Employee Falls from Scaffold and Is Injured

Abstract: At approximately 9:15 a.m. on July 2, 2012, Employee #1 was involved in a construction activity and working from a rolling Perry scaffold. The scaffold was approximately 5.67 ft in height. While Employee was occupying the scaffolding, it moved and rolled on a covered hole that was 6.5 in. wide, 18 in. long and 21 in. deep. The hole was concealed with a 0.001 in. malleable safety sheet metal covering; however, it did not support the weight of the scaffold and gave in. The scaffolding tipped over, and Employee #1 fell to a concrete floor. He used his hands to break his fall and sustained bilateral distal fractures to his wrists and mildly displaced nasal fracture. Employee #1 was transported to a medical center, where he received treatment and was then hospitalized for three days.
